Output 456d85336aabcc326fa40b113e110f6e7f5bf413ae6a2ee12de79309fefcd542:0

value
3490656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4142418c24d0336a40f9e08f64f1bbb34418dba9 OP_EQUAL
address
MDrDXT3ZksTfTGsVeHTCpt1cyhWVe6D658
transaction
456d85336aabcc326fa40b113e110f6e7f5bf413ae6a2ee12de79309fefcd542
spent
true